Transaction 52138002bf9499f93d05b6a06fb644d66e893f11f2ae8d809c7b5b6dad0166a5

1 Input
2 Outputs
  • 52138002bf9499f93d05b6a06fb644d66e893f11f2ae8d809c7b5b6dad0166a5:0
  • value  4903587150
    address  155zoVuJ2g7DGCKrykgRjGTVBQXfDFmZwE
  • 52138002bf9499f93d05b6a06fb644d66e893f11f2ae8d809c7b5b6dad0166a5:1
  • value  122350000
    address  1NAF3CuanxEoyQc1GzWFKNNPXHKKHnjQCL